Monnamogolo wa Thulaganyo

Monnamogolo wa Thulaganyo is a musician from Serowe, Botswana, who has been active in the local music scene since 2015. He initially started his career singing traditional music and has released several songs, including "Somola Tsenya," "Kgarebe se mo Neele," and "Lepiano la Botswana." However, it was his hit song "Thoma ka Serethe" that brought him widespread recognition, sparking dance challenges across social media platforms, including in neighboring South Africa. The song's success has led to him being nicknamed "Thoma ka Serethe" after the viral hit.

Monnamogolo wa Thulaganyo has continued to make waves in the music scene, with recent performances such as his first appearance at the Easter Eve Bash in 2024. His music often reflects local themes and styles, contributing to his growing popularity in Botswana and beyond. Some of his notable recent releases include "Yame le ditsala," "Tsena Rasta," and "Thoma Ka Serethe (Remix)".
